#4da2e3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4da2e3 is composed of 30.2% red, 63.5% green and 89%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.1% cyan, 28.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 206 degrees, a saturation of 72.8% and a lightness of 59.6%. #4da2e3 color hex could be obtained by blending #9affff with #0045c7.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

#4da2e3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4da2e3 has RGB values of R:77, G:162, B:227 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0.29,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 5087971.

Shades and Tints of #4da2e3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010508 is the darkest color, while #f6fbfe is the lightest one.
